输出级管子用过二种,一是:2N4403/4401,还有是英国管ZTX450/550,但二种管都存在低频这个问题,感觉用4403/4401管低频要好于ZTX管,但中频ZTX管要好于4403/4401管。
差分输入我用的是BL档的K170/J74

陈达财最近的我没看资料,我看08年的是Rd=150R,Rs=10R,
按照JC-2原作者本人John Curl的介绍:
Idss of input fets should be 25ma or more.
__________________14th April 2009, 12:11 AM
Parallel 2 V series Toshiba fets.
14th April 2009, 02:18 AM
输入级JFET的Idss要25mA或大于,达不到时用2对V档的东芝JFET管并联,
V档Idss:10~20mA
网友Aneat问
:less than 15mA why is not recommend for?
when Idss is smaller we can increase Rd & decrease Rs,the way whether not good?
John Curl昨天(2010/06/06)的回答:
Sorry that I did not get back to answer questions, I didn't see this thread for awhile.
Unfortunately, I cannot give additional info on the JC-2 attenuators, as I did not design them.
The original JC-2 design was done in 1973, or 37 years ago. At that time, all we had available to us were Siliconix j-fets, in general, and for special applications, Union Carbide, Motorola, or Crystalonics.
The JC-2 phono input stage used Siliconix J110 input devices that are high current switches, that usually have an Idss of over 20 ma. The input devices were used at about 15 ma ea for lowest possible input noise. When you change the Id of the input devices in order to use lower Idss types, then you MUST change the load resistors, and this LOWERS the open loop bandwidth. Still, the change is not too great, IF you use high Idss devices like the 2SK170 V series. Running at 1/2 the originally designed current is not too different, BUT it will be another design if you run less.
The output j-fets of the phono stage. Lowering the Idss on these devices will lower the slew rate significantly, if taken too far.
The same problem with the complementary j-fets in the input driver stage. It is designed with a very high open loop bandwidth, on purpose, and this will be lost IF the input stage load resistors are increased too much. Still the V series 2SK170 and 2SJ74 series will work pretty well, for the output of the phono stage and the input of the line driver amp, with resistor changes.

提高供电电压的做法,我于以前所装的(佛山伟良兄版本F5)里已试过,当时从原来的15V提至19V,后级管改用了中功率5171/1930,输出管电流只调至12MA,直接推耳机时感觉低频还是不足,且分析力可能因为改用中功率管的原因,而有所下降.今次再装,亦打算把供电电压替至22-25V之间,看看会否有所改善.:loveliness:
